MEP AIS Configuration
Description:
MEP AIS configuration
'prio' is the priority (PCP) of transmitted AIS frame
'1s|1m' is the number of AIS frame pr. second
'set|clear' is set or clear of protection usability. If set, the first 3 AIS frames are transmitted as fast as possible - this gives
protection reliability in the path end-point.
Syntax:
MEP ais config [<inst>] [<prio>] [1s|1m] [set|clear] [enable|disable]
Parameters:
<inst> : Instance number
<prio> : OAM PDU priority
1s|1m : Transmit period for AIS
1s - to send OAM Frames in the rate of 1 per second
1m - to send OAM frames in the rate of 1 per minute
set|clear : Protection usability set/clear
enable|disable: enable/disable
